The country has just passed from the 2nd election for the constituent assembly. Assuring the minimum level of women in the house has been a real challenge; however the recent CA election results have shown a clear decline in the presence of women lawmakers in the house. Despite hard struggle and pressure of women activists and civil society the political parties of the country have failed to keep the level of women's presence in the CA to a level of 33% as like in the previous CA. INTRODUCTION Empowerment in general and specifically political empowerment of women is an ongoing struggle of not only in least developed countries and developing countries but also in the developed world. It has been noted by a research work undertaken recently on women s participation in the leadership positions of major political parties of Nepal Acharya 2013 that in most of the countries women s political participation is measure and assessed looking into women s participation in the electoral process of the country both at local as well as national level however the actual source of developing qualified experienced and strong women candidates takes place within the political parties. If the presence of strong women leaders within the political parties at different levels becomes high there will be no dearth of strong women candidates to represent the political parties in the elections and win the seat. However as in many countries of the region Nepal is not exception to this. This paper intends to discuss the issues and challenges faced by the country in increasing women s presence in the law making bodies and also by the political parties and individual women .
